Parents, are you making your to-do list? Let’s help each other out, what are we forgetting?
✅ registration in Skyward
✅ put money on School cafe lunch accounts
✅ get physical if in athletics
✅ get band instrument/pay for rental if in band
✅ shop for school supplies
✅ attend Meet the Teacher
✅ drop meds off with the nurse (if you need to)
Drop-Off Hours & Schedule
Standard Drop-Off Hours:
Monday–Friday, 8:00 AM–3:00 PM
Special Schedule for Tuesday, August 11th (Convocation):
1:00 PM–3:00 PM
No morning drop-offs due to Convocation.
Quick Reminders
-All medications must be in their original, labeled packaging.
-Prescription medications must have the appropriate prescription label and directions.
-For students under 12, please provide age-appropriate children’s over-the-counter medication. For example, please send Children’s Tylenol rather than an adult-strength Tylenol product.
-Medications must be brought to the front office by a parent/guardian or other authorized adult. Students should not bring medications to school themselves.
